Global-MINDS is an English-language master degree program co-funded by the European Union. It is a unique study program with an indispensable internationalisation component. It is aimed at students with a Bachelor (or similar) degree in psychology, and is designed to deliver high quality international training in scientific knowledge and practical skills in social and cultural psychology.

The courses provide students the opportunity to acquire in-depth theoretical knowledge on themes of extreme social relevance, including diversity, inclusion and migration. Students consolidate and apply this knowledge while gaining first-hand intercultural experience. The 2-year program consists of two semesters of full time course work in the first year, at two different universities. This is followed, in the second year, by a semester internship with an organisation or company organised in association with the partner university of the student’s choice, and a final semester for completing and defending the thesis.
